The Evolution of "Loool" in Digital Communication
The digital landscape has witnessed a fascinating shift in online communication , particularly concerning the evolution of "Loool." Originally a playful twist of "LOL" (Laugh Out Loud), "Loool" emerged as a way to heighten amusement and convey more laughter than the standard acronym. Its initial usage often signaled sincere amusement, but over years it has undergone a complex semantic shift . Now, "Loool" can be used playfully to respond to situations, sometimes devoid of any real humor. This trend highlights the fluid and constantly changing nature of online language , demonstrating how a simple modification of a familiar term can acquire multiple meanings and associations. The proliferation of "Loool" also reflects a broader tendency to employ exaggerated or distorted representations to express sentiment in the online world .
- Early usage indicated genuine amusement.
- Current usage can be ironic or sarcastic.
- Reflects the fluidity of online language.

Decoding "Loool": Meaning and Variations
Interpreting "Loool" can be confusing to those check here unfamiliar with internet language. It's essentially a variation of "lol," which initially stood for "laugh out loud." The additional "o"s signify an intensification of the laughter, indicating that the writer finds something particularly funny. However, "Loool" and its numerous forms, such as "Lool," "Loll," or even "Looooooooool," can also be used ironically to convey disbelief , rather than genuine amusement. Context is key to determining the intended significance .
